Australian Ringneck (Barnardius zonarius)
The Australian Ringneck is a distinctive parrot found across much of Australia, with several regional subspecies occupying remarkably different environments. The birds depicted in this artwork are the south-western subspecies commonly known as the Twenty-Eight, named after its unmistakable call, which many listeners hear as the words "twenty-eight."
Restricted largely to the Jarrah, Marri, and Karri forests of south-west Western Australia, Twenty-Eights feed on seeds, fruits, blossoms, nectar, insects, and the developing nuts of native eucalypts. Their strong, curved beaks enable them to exploit a wide variety of food sources throughout the seasons. Unlike many of Australia's larger parrots that gather in noisy flocks, Australian Ringnecks are more often encountered in pairs, family groups, or small loose gatherings. As they move through the forest they assist with seed dispersal and interact closely with flowering trees, making them an important part of the ecology of these unique south-western woodlands.

CONSERVATION INFORMATION.

This design donates to animal and conservation efforts
The Australian Ringneck remains widespread and secure across its extensive range, occupying habitats from coastal woodland and mallee scrub to inland forests and semi-arid landscapes. Although populations are generally stable, local conservation challenges vary between regions and subspecies.
Like many native parrots, Australian Ringnecks depend on mature hollow-bearing trees for nesting, making the retention of old-growth woodland important for long-term breeding success. Habitat clearing, particularly in agricultural districts, can reduce available nesting sites, while some populations have adapted successfully to modified landscapes and occasionally come into conflict with orchardists and grain growers. Conserving native woodland and protecting mature trees will help ensure these colourful parrots continue to thrive throughout Australia's diverse landscapes.
